resplice
Verb
/rɪˈsplaɪs/

Definition
To splice again or anew.

Examples
- The technician needed to resplice the cables to restore the connection.
- After the initial splice failed, they had to resplice the film to continue with editing.

Meaning
Resplice means to join or connect (pieces of something) once more, particularly in the context of cutting and rejoining strands of material such as rope, film, or electrical wiring.

Synonyms
- Reconnect
- Rejoin
- Reattach
